加入收藏 | 设为首页 | 会员中心 | 我要投稿 91站长网 (https://www.91zhanzhang.com/)- 机器学习、操作系统、大数据、低代码、数据湖!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

MsSQL数据库界面优化与高效管理策略解析

发布时间:2025-09-15 09:46:48 所属栏目:MsSql教程 来源:DaWei
导读: 在大数据时代,数据库不仅是数据存储的载体,更是业务系统高效运转的核心。作为大数据开发工程师,我们深知MsSQL数据库在企业级应用中的重要地位。然而,随着数据量的激增与业务逻辑的复杂化,传统数据库管理方式

在大数据时代,数据库不仅是数据存储的载体,更是业务系统高效运转的核心。作为大数据开发工程师,我们深知MsSQL数据库在企业级应用中的重要地位。然而,随着数据量的激增与业务逻辑的复杂化,传统数据库管理方式已难以满足高并发、低延迟的需求。因此,对MsSQL数据库的界面优化与高效管理策略进行深入探讨,具有现实意义。


MsSQL的管理界面主要依赖于SSMS(SQL Server Management Studio),虽然功能强大,但在实际使用中常常面临响应缓慢、操作复杂等问题。为此,我们可以引入轻量级客户端工具,如Azure Data Studio,其跨平台支持和插件扩展能力显著提升了操作效率。定制化开发数据库管理前端,结合Web技术实现可视化监控与操作,也能有效提升用户体验。


界面优化只是提升效率的第一步,真正的核心在于数据库的高效管理策略。MsSQL数据库的性能瓶颈往往出现在查询响应时间与资源利用率上。我们可以通过定期分析执行计划、优化慢查询、合理使用索引等方式,显著提升数据库性能。同时,避免全表扫描和频繁的锁竞争,是提高并发处理能力的关键。


数据库的结构设计直接影响到系统的可维护性与扩展性。在表结构设计时,应遵循规范化原则,同时根据业务需求适度反规范化,以减少连接查询的开销。分区表的使用也是应对大数据量的有效手段,将数据按时间或业务维度进行划分,不仅提升查询效率,也有利于数据归档与备份。


AI模拟效果图,仅供参考

自动化运维是现代数据库管理不可或缺的一部分。通过编写T-SQL脚本或借助SQL Server Agent,可以实现定时备份、日志清理、性能监控等任务。结合PowerShell或Python脚本,还可以实现更复杂的自动化流程,如自动扩容、异常告警与自动恢复,从而降低人工干预频率,提升系统稳定性。


安全性管理同样不可忽视。MsSQL提供了丰富的权限控制机制,合理配置登录账户、数据库用户与角色权限,能够有效防止越权访问。同时,启用加密连接、审计日志记录与数据脱敏策略,可以进一步保障数据在传输与存储过程中的安全。


持续监控与性能调优应成为日常管理的重要组成部分。通过内置的动态管理视图(DMV)和性能计数器,可以实时掌握数据库运行状态。结合第三方监控工具,如Prometheus+Grafana,可以实现可视化告警与趋势预测,为系统优化提供数据支撑。

(编辑:91站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章